Long-Term Longevity and Capability
If you're considering dental implants, you'll be pleased to know that their long-term durability and functionality make them an excellent choice for replacing missing teeth.
Unlike other tooth substitute alternatives, such as dentures or bridges, oral implants are made to last a life time with proper care.
Made from a solid titanium product, these implants fuse with the jawbone, offering a secure structure for fabricated teeth. This indicates you can enjoy the liberty of consuming your preferred foods without worrying about your teeth moving or sliding.
Furthermore, dental implants feel and look like natural teeth, giving you a positive smile.
While the upfront expense of dental implants may be higher contrasted to various other options, their resilient benefits and boosted dental health make them a beneficial investment.

Possible Threats and Factors To Consider
When taking into consideration oral implants, it's important to be familiar with the possible dangers and factors to consider. While oral implants supply countless advantages, it's critical to recognize the potential drawbacks too. Here are some crucial indicate consider:
- Infection: Like any kind of surgical procedure, there is a danger of infection. Nevertheless, with proper oral hygiene and routine oral check-ups, the threat can be reduced.
- Bone loss: In some cases, oral implants can lead to bone loss around the dental implant site. This can be prevented by maintaining excellent oral hygiene and following your dentist's instructions.
